Gertrude’s Children’s Hospital, the Daktari Smart Telemedicine Program

The Challenge:
Facilitating healthcare for the 72% of Kenyans who live outside of urban areas and face long journeys to seek care in a health system that’s already buckling from overcrowded hospitals and healthcare worker scarcity.

The Approach:
Leveraging telemedicine technology for remote clinical exams that are as close to in-person care as possible for pediatric patients 

The Outcome:
